GSoC Project | Basic Support for Trace Compass

Ravindra Kumar Meena rmeena840 at gmail.com
Tue Aug 6 06:34:34 UTC 2019


>
> > The decoded thread name is "swi6: task queu"
> >
> > For each RTEMS_RECORD_THREAD_NAME event you start the loop at i == 0, so
> > you overwrite your previous data.
>
> The thread name encoding was difficult to decode. I changed it like this:
>
>
> https://git.rtems.org/rtems/commit/?id=cc91fae43a71ccb5f47fa7ed179dd86c53e290ae
>
> I pushed new raw data to the repository.
>
Okay.

This is how Konsole output looks like:
Object Index: 1 Name: IDLE
Object Index: 2 Name: IDLE
Object Index: 3 Name: IDLE
Object Index: 4 Name: IDLE
Object Index: 5 Name: IDLE
Object Index: 6 Name: IDLE
Object Index: 7 Name: IDLE
Object Index: 8 Name: IDLE
Object Index: 9 Name: IDLE
Object Index: 10 Name: IDLE
Object Index: 11 Name: IDLE
Object Index: 12 Name: IDLE
Object Index: 13 Name: IDLE
Object Index: 14 Name: IDLE
Object Index: 15 Name: IDLE
Object Index: 16 Name: IDLE
Object Index: 17 Name: IDLE
Object Index: 18 Name: IDLE
Object Index: 19 Name: IDLE
Object Index: 20 Name: IDLE
Object Index: 21 Name: IDLE
Object Index: 22 Name: IDLE
Object Index: 23 Name: IDLE
Object Index: 24 Name: IDLE
Object Index: 1 Name: UI1
Object Index: 2 Name: BSWP
Object Index: 3 Name: BRDA
Object Index: 4 Name: MDIA
Object Index: 5 Name: TIME
Object Index: 6 Name: IRQS
Object Index: 7 Name: IRQS
Object Index: 8 Name: IRQS
Object Index: 9 Name: IRQS
Object Index: 10 Name: IRQS
Object Index: 11 Name: IRQS
Object Index: 12 Name: IRQS
Object Index: 13 Name: IRQS
Object Index: 14 Name: IRQS
Object Index: 15 Name: IRQS
Object Index: 16 Name: IRQS
Object Index: 17 Name: IRQS
Object Index: 18 Name: IRQS
Object Index: 19 Name: IRQS
Object Index: 20 Name: IRQS
Object Index: 21 Name: IRQS
Object Index: 22 Name: IRQS
Object Index: 23 Name: IRQS
Object Index: 24 Name: IRQS
Object Index: 25 Name: IRQS
Object Index: 26 Name: IRQS
Object Index: 27 Name: IRQS
Object Index: 28 Name: IRQS
Object Index: 29 Name: IRQS
Object Index: 30 Name: swi6
Object Index: 30 Name: swi6sk q
Object Index: 31 Name: conf
Object Index: 32 Name: swi5
Object Index: 32 Name: swi5st t
Object Index: 33 Name: kque
Object Index: 33 Name: kquetx t
Object Index: 34 Name: thre
Object Index: 34 Name: threaskq
Object Index: 35 Name: swi6
Object Index: 35 Name: swi6ant
Object Index: 36 Name: swi1
Object Index: 36 Name: swi1tisr
Object Index: 37 Name: soft
Object Index: 37 Name: soft0
Object Index: 38 Name: DHCP
Object Index: 39 Name: PRTL
Object Index: 40 Name: PSTA
Object Index: 41 Name: PRTL
Object Index: 42 Name: PSTA
Object Index: 43 Name: FTPa
Object Index: 44 Name: FTPb
Object Index: 45 Name: FTPc
Object Index: 46 Name: FTPd
Object Index: 47 Name: FTPe
Object Index: 48 Name: FTPf
Object Index: 49 Name: FTPg
Object Index: 50 Name: FTPh
Object Index: 51 Name: FTPi
Object Index: 52 Name: FTPj
Object Index: 53 Name: FTPk
Object Index: 54 Name: FTPl
Object Index: 55 Name: FTPm
Object Index: 56 Name: FTPn
Object Index: 57 Name: FTPo
Object Index: 58 Name: FTPp
Object Index: 59 Name: FTPq
Object Index: 60 Name: FTPr
Object Index: 61 Name: FTPs
Object Index: 62 Name: FTPt
Object Index: 63 Name: FTPu
Object Index: 64 Name: FTPv
Object Index: 65 Name: FTPw
Object Index: 66 Name: FTPx
Object Index: 67 Name: FTPD
Object Index: 68 Name: TNTa
Object Index: 69 Name: TNTb
Object Index: 70 Name: TNTc
Object Index: 71 Name: TNTd
Object Index: 72 Name: TNTe
Object Index: 73 Name: TNTD
Object Index: 74 Name: RCRD
Object Index: 75 Name: SHLL

Thread name is in the right order now.


-- 
*Ravindra Kumar Meena*,
B. Tech. Computer Science and Engineering,
Indian Institute of Technology (Indian School of Mines)
<https://www.iitism.ac.in/>, Dhanbad
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.rtems.org/pipermail/devel/attachments/20190806/d5d3c464/attachment-0002.html>


More information about the devel mailing list